adjective A2 property
1

very attractive in appearance

Looking very nice or beautiful.

Kullanım kalıbı: [someone/something] is lovely
Sık yapılan hata:
Learners sometimes confuse 'lovely' with 'loveable'. 'Lovely' means beautiful or pleasant, while 'loveable' means easy to love because of personality.
Eş anlamlılar
beautiful (Often stronger and more formal; lovely can sound warmer or more personal.)
Zıt anlamlılar
ugly (Direct opposite in terms of physical attractiveness.)
Eşdizimler
lovely smile |lovely dress |lovely view |lovely day
Konular
appearance |emotions |daily life |core_vocabulary
Örnekler
  • She wore a lovely blue dress to the party.
  • The garden is especially lovely in the spring.
  • What a lovely view from your balcony!
Öğrenenler için örnekler
  • This is a lovely house.
  • She has a lovely face.
  • It is a lovely park.
adjective A2 property
2

very pleasant or enjoyable

Making you feel happy and comfortable.

Kullanım kalıbı: [someone/something] is lovely
Sık yapılan hata:
Some learners overuse 'lovely' in formal writing; in formal contexts, 'pleasant' or 'enjoyable' may be preferred.
Eş anlamlılar
delightful (More formal; similar meaning of giving great pleasure.)
Zıt anlamlılar
unpleasant (Opposite in terms of causing discomfort or dislike.)
Eşdizimler
lovely time |lovely meal |lovely evening |lovely weather
Konular
emotions |daily life |core_vocabulary
Örnekler
  • We had a lovely time at the picnic.
  • It was such a lovely afternoon by the lake.
  • Thanks for the lovely dinner last night.
Öğrenenler için örnekler
  • We had a lovely day at the beach.
  • It is lovely weather today.
  • The party was lovely.
adjective informal B1 property
3

kind and thoughtful in behavior

Being very nice and friendly to other people.

Kullanım kalıbı: [someone] is lovely to [someone]
Sık yapılan hata:
Learners sometimes confuse this with physical attractiveness; here it refers to personality and actions.
Eş anlamlılar
kind (More general; 'lovely' here adds warmth and affection.)
Zıt anlamlılar
rude (Opposite in terms of manner and politeness.)
Eşdizimler
lovely person |lovely friend |lovely host
Konular
emotions |relationships |core_vocabulary
Örnekler
  • She’s such a lovely person to work with.
  • You’ve been absolutely lovely to me since I arrived.
  • He’s always lovely with the kids.
Öğrenenler için örnekler
  • My teacher is very lovely to us.
  • She is a lovely friend.
  • They are lovely people.
İsim informal B2 entity
4

affectionate term for someone liked

A sweet name you call someone you like or love.

Kullanım kalıbı: Hello, [lovely]! / Thanks, [lovely]!
Sık yapılan hata:
Learners may not realize this usage is more common in British English and can sound unusual in American English.
Eş anlamlılar
darling ('Darling' is more intimate; 'lovely' can be friendly as well as romantic.)
Konular
relationships |emotions |communication
Örnekler
  • Thanks for helping me, lovely.
  • Morning, lovely! Did you sleep well?
  • You all right, lovely?
Öğrenenler için örnekler
  • Hello, lovely! How are you?
  • Thank you, lovely.
  • Good night, lovely.

Kelime biçimleri
Adjective
  • Base: lovely
  • Comparative: lovelier
  • Superlative: loveliest
Noun
  • Base: lovely
  • Plural: lovelies
